Fiorentina coach Cesare Prandelli has said that he wants Franck Ribery to be a greater reference point on the pitch for the Gigliati.

The Viola face Hellas Verona on Saturday afternoon in Serie A and the tactician wants to see the French veteran create a greater influence on the pitch.

“We have to make him more of a leader in a way in which gives us greater numerical superiority,” Prandelli said in his press conference.

“He does not have to solve problems alone but he has to be our point of reference.”

Serbian starlet Dusan Vlahovic starred alongside Ribery and scored the penalty in the 1-1 draw against Sassuolo on Wednesday evening and Prandelli prefers to utilise him over Patrick Cutrone and Christian Kouame.

“From a working point of view, I cannot fault Cutrone and Kouame for anything, but I think that Vlahovic has the right characteristics for how I interpret the role of a striker at this moment,” the Fiorentina coach said.

“Cutrone in the penalty area is very good but at the moment I have chosen Vlahovic. I see he is calm and I wish that he unleashes himself.”
